Stevens Pass carries US-2 over the Cascade Range at 4,061 ft. Here's what to watch, and when it bites.
Stevens is higher and snowier than Snoqualmie, and US-2 over the summit closes regularly through the winter for avalanche control and heavy snowfall — sometimes for extended windows when the avalanche danger is high above the highway. Check the cameras before you leave; conditions here turn quickly.
The Stevens Pass ski resort sits right at the summit, so winter weekends stack recreational traffic on top of freight and commuters — on a snowy Saturday the combination of a chain requirement and a full parking lot can crawl the highway.
